Linux服务器版安装全攻略:从准备到部署
在当今的互联网基础设施中,Linux服务器操作系统凭借其开源、稳定、高效和安全等特性,占据了绝对主导地位。无论是搭建Web服务、数据库还是云计算平台,掌握Linux服务器版的安装都是系统管理员和开发者的必备技能。本文将详细解析Linux服务器版的安装过程,助您从零开始构建稳固的服务器基石。
安装前的关键准备工作

成功的安装始于周密的准备。首先,您需要根据服务器用途选择合适的发行版。对于企业级应用,CentOS Stream或Rocky Linux因其卓越的稳定性备受青睐;若追求最新的软件特性,Ubuntu Server是不错的选择;而Debian则以“坚如磐石”著称。确定发行版后,访问其官方网站下载最新的ISO镜像文件。硬件方面,请确保服务器至少拥有2GB内存、20GB硬盘空间及稳定的网络连接。最后,准备一个8GB以上的U盘,使用Rufus或balenaEtcher等工具将ISO镜像写入其中,制作成可启动的安装介质。
启动安装与核心配置详解

将制作好的安装介质插入服务器,从U盘启动后,将进入图形化或文本式安装界面。首先面临的是语言和键盘布局选择,建议根据实际需求设置。接下来是最关键的磁盘分区环节:对于服务器环境,推荐手动分区以优化性能和安全。一个典型的分区方案包括:为/boot分配500MB-1GB(存放内核);swap分区大小通常为物理内存的1-2倍;为根目录“/”分配剩余的大部分空间。若需单独存储数据,可额外创建/home或/var分区。分区完成后,需设置网络配置,建议使用静态IP地址以确保服务器地址固定,并正确配置网关和DNS服务器。
软件选择与系统安全加固
在软件选择阶段,服务器版安装器通常会提供“最小化安装”选项,仅安装核心系统,这能最大程度减少攻击面并节省资源。根据服务器角色,您可额外勾选所需软件包组,例如:Web服务器需选择“LAMP Stack”或“Nginx”;数据库服务器则需MySQL/PostgreSQL。安装过程中必须设置root管理员密码并创建至少一个普通用户账户,遵循最小权限原则。同时开启SSH服务以便远程管理,但务必禁用root的SSH直接登录,并考虑使用密钥认证替代密码登录,这些是基础的安全加固步骤。
首次启动与后续优化
安装完成并重启后,系统将首次以全新状态运行。首先应以新建的普通用户身份登录,通过sudo命令执行管理任务。紧接着运行sudo apt update && sudo apt upgrade(基于Debian/Ubuntu)或sudo dnf update(基于RHEL)来更新所有软件包,修补已知漏洞。为保障服务器持续稳定运行,建议配置防火墙(如firewalld或ufw)和SELinux/AppArmor安全模块。最后,设置定时任务(cron)以执行定期更新和日志轮替,并考虑部署监控工具(如Prometheus节点导出器)来掌握系统健康状况。
Linux服务器版的安装并非终点,而是系统生命周期的起点。通过严谨的安装流程和持续的安全维护,您将获得一个高性能、高可靠性的服务器环境,为各种网络服务提供强有力的支撑。随着经验的积累,您还可以探索自动化安装工具(如Kickstart或Cloud-Init),实现大规模服务器的快速、一致部署,进一步提升运维效率。

评论(3)
发表评论